Mississippi State Sends Reese and Eight Recruits to 2026 Draft Combine
Ace Reese, a third‑baseman for Mississippi State, is the only current Bulldog invited to the 2026 MLB Draft Combine, which will be held in Phoenix from June 23‑25. The event precedes the MLB Draft in Philadelphia on July 11‑12.
Eight Mississippi State prospects — catcher Will Brick, outfielder Martin Shelar, pitchers Wilson Andersen and Denton Lord, infielder Landon Brown, and arms Jacob Carbaugh and Noah Danza — have earned invitations and draft rankings from MLB.com.
The combine comes as the program enjoys a resurgence under coach Brian O’Connor, who guided the Bulldogs to the Athens Super Regional in his inaugural season, and as Reese joins alumni Rafael Palmeiro and Will Clark in achieving consecutive 20‑home‑run years.
Reese, ranked No. 21 by MLB.com, transferred to Mississippi State before the 2025 campaign and posted a .336 average with 24 homers, 74 RBIs and 73 runs, positioning him as a potential first‑round pick and the first position player from the school to be drafted in the first round since Justin Foscue in 2020.
